09:41 — Heads up for review: the Ladlefox recipe-scaling calculator started rounding fractional cups to zero for batch sizes under four servings. Root cause was an integer cast sneaking into the unit converter during the Thimbleware refactor. Priya patched it and added property tests for tiny batches. The fixed build is referenced by the token below.

pipeline stamp: htk31_f769b577b3028a4e9958e5bb8d1259a

/*
 * DRIFT_CORRECTION_INTERVAL_SEC
 *
 * Heads up, reviewer: the humidity sensors in the Fernhollow greenhouse
 * controllers drift upward about 0.3% per day once the enclosure warms up.
 * This constant sets how often we recalibrate against the reference probe.
 * Shorter intervals hammer the sensor bus; longer ones let drift sneak past
 * the irrigation thresholds and the basil gets soggy. Don't let anyone
 * "optimize" this without checking the drift logs. Calibration curves were
 * fitted using the following build.
 */

build token for kagaf-hahof: htk14_9d3d4d26d7d8de

// Reviewer note: the Tabulon spreadsheet export previously buffered the
// entire workbook in memory, which blew past 2 GB on large tenant exports.
// This client now streams rows through the Sheetforge internal service in
// 10k-row chunks, flushing each chunk before requesting the next. If you
// change the chunk size, verify heap profiles under the load fixture in
// test/fixtures/export_large. The client below authenticates to Sheetforge
// with a service-scoped key; the current value is on the following line.

service key, yadug-bajog: zpat3_pou

## Changelog — Font vendoring defaults changed

As of this release, the Bracken UI build no longer fetches third-party fonts at build time. All typefaces used by the Lanternwell suite are now vendored into the repo under a dedicated assets directory, and the fetch step is skipped by default. If you're onboarding, nothing to install — the fonts travel with the checkout. The build flags controlling this behavior are listed below.

settings of hadup-yafog:
LAMAEL_PIN=3761
LAMAEL_TENANT=istmir
LAMAEL_METRICS_HOST=metrics.lamael.plorvasys.test
LAMAEL_SEAL=seal_8ea68500
LAMAEL_STANDBY_TEAM=fraok